Background
Interleukin-2 (IL 2), also known as T cell growth factor, is a member of the cytokine family, including IL-4, IL-7, IL-9, IL-15, and IL-21. Each member of this family has a bundle of four α spirals. IL-2 signals through IL-2 receptors, which are complexes of dendritic subunits called α, β, and γ. γIL-2R is common to the cytokine receptors of all members of the cytokine family. Mature IL2 mice share 56% and 73% of aa sequence identity with human and rat IL2, respectively. Produced by CD4+ Tcells, CD8+ T cells, γ δ T cells, B cells, dendritic cells, and eosinophils, IL-2 plays a vital role in key immune system function, tolerance, and immunity, primarily due to its potent stimulating activity against T cells. Therefore, IL2 may be a key cytokine that naturally suppresses autoimmunity.
